Code Orange Explain Vocals On Latest Album
. He says they were unhappy being tagged as "the really heavy band with the female vocalist" so they made a conscious effort to bring the guitars to the fore on the follow-up to 2012's Love Is Love/Return To Dust. He tells this month's edition of Metal Hammer: "We shared vocal duties more this time and we wanted to push Eric Balderose's guitars towards the front.
